CHILD-FRIENDLY ETERNAL ANCHOR!

Hebrews 6:19 GNT

We have this hope as an anchor for our lives. It is safe and sure, and goes through the curtain of the heavenly temple into the inner sanctuary.

 

Every ship, no matter how big or beautiful, needs an anchor. Without an anchor, the ship will drift away — the wind can push it, the water can pull it, and storms can shake it. The book of Hebrews uses this picture to show what God has given every believer: an eternal anchor. 

This anchor is not temporary. It is strong, steady, and forever. It is Jesus.

In our world, many things change — our feelings, our friends, our situations, our health, and even our strength. But God gives us something that never changes. Hope in Jesus is an anchor that keeps our hearts steady, even when life feels confusing or scary.

This anchor is built on God’s promise. Hebrews 6 says God gave two unchanging things: His promise and His oath. God didn’t have to swear an oath, but He did it to show us how serious and faithful He is.

This means your hope is not anchored in how good you are, how you feel, or what is happening around you. 

Your hope is anchored in who God is.

Abraham held onto hope even when things looked impossible, because “He who promised is faithful.” His anchor held!

Anchors are tested in storms, not in calm weather. 

David faced fear and danger but said, “My heart is steadfast.” His anchor held. 

Paul faced trouble and prison but said, “None of these things move me.” His anchor held. 

The disciples panicked in the storm, but Jesus was calm — because He was the anchor in the boat.

Your storm does not decide your future. Your anchor does.

This anchor is tied to Jesus in heaven — not to anything on earth. That is why your heart can rest even when life feels shaky.

The anchor keeps you from drifting. Drifting happens slowly — through discouragement, disappointment, delay, or distraction. But hope in Jesus keeps you steady and strong.

This hope is eternal. It never breaks, rusts, or fades. It is a living hope, a blessed hope, an anchor for your soul — for today and for every day.
